The building designed by Sydney Mitchell and Wilson was constructed in 1899-1900.

The Scots Renaissance church and offices are formed from a four-bay plan over two storeys. The property is faced in smooth red sandstone ashlar, painted to ground.

Bays are divided by pilasters, channelled at the ground, with fluted Ionic pilasters at the first floor. Continuous cornices can be found at the ground floor and at the eaves.

There is a ecessed two-leaf timber panelled door with leaded glass in decorative fanlight in a key-blocked round-arched surround with broken pediment containing cartouche to outer left. There also exist decorative wrought-iron gates.

In terms of fenestation there is a three-light mullioned and transomed window in the second bay from the left, and a two-bay shop to the right. There are four tall round-arched windows with geometric tracery and clear leaded glass at 1st floor.

A blind oculus in central shaped wallhead gable is flanked by a parapet. Finally, there is a pitched roof with gablet roof behind pediment and two gables to rear forming F-plan.
